An Information Management Professional's Introduction To Innovation Management Tools

an introduction by Matthew Brown


Executive Summary (This is a document excerpt)

Great ideas to improve the bottom line can come from anywhere within a business. Increasingly, companies include upper management, line-of-business people, and external sources like customers, partners, and suppliers in the innovation process. So it's no surprise that businesses often ask information and knowledge management (I&KM) professionals to help them navigate the innovation management marketplace. A new report by Forrester is a must-read for any I&KM pro looking to evaluate innovation management tools.
